Owner's Capital
The total equity or financial contribution provided by the owner(s) of a business.
Prepaid Insurance
An asset account that represents payments made for insurance coverage before the coverage period.
Trial Balance
A bookkeeping worksheet in which the balances of all ledgers are compiled into debit and credit account columns to ensure accuracy.
Accounts Receivable
Dues from clients to a corporation for goods or services already benefited from but yet to be paid for.
